KEYS: fix "ca_keys=" partial key matching



The call to asymmetric_key_hex_to_key_id() from ca_keys_setup()
silently fails with -ENOMEM.  Instead of dynamically allocating
memory from a __setup function, this patch defines a variable
and calls __asymmetric_key_hex_to_key_id(), a new helper function,
directly.

This bug was introduced by 'commit 46963b77 ("KEYS: Overhaul
key identification when searching for asymmetric keys")'.

Changelog:
- for clarification, rename hexlen to asciihexlen in
  asymmetric_key_hex_to_key_id()
- add size argument to __asymmetric_key_hex_to_key_id() - David Howells
- inline __asymmetric_key_hex_to_key_id() - David Howells
- remove duplicate strlen() calls
